Right triangle ACB has side lengths c = 17 inches and a = 8 inches

a²+b²=c²

Where a=leg, b=base, and c=hypotenuse.

So, because we are given the side lengths of c and a, we simply plug everything in, and try to find b.

a²+b²=c²

8² + b² = 17²

Simplify.

64 + b² = 289

Subtract 64 from both sides.

b² = 289 - 64

Simplify.

b² = 225

b = [tex] \sqrt{225} [/tex]

So, b = 15 inches
